Curtiss-Wright Corporation announced that it won a contract by Raytheon Technologies to provide its rugged Modular Open Systems Approach (MOSA)-based processor and networking modules for use in the Next Generation Special Mission Processor (NextGen SMP). According to the company, the NextGen SMP is intended to serve as the central processing component of the AC/MC-130J aircraft.

In order to achieve and maintain warfighting overmatch, coordinate deployed forces, and enable new warfighting capabilities, the U.S. Army, Air Force, Navy, Marine Corps, and Space Force are actively looking to new programs such as Joint All Domain Command and Control (JADC2) to ensure warfighters have maximum situational awareness. This push to upgrade is driving the development of end-to-end networks linking the cloud, command posts, combat platforms, and dismounted warfighters. It also anticipates the addition of vast numbers of sensors and video feeds – backed by big data processing, artificial intelligence, and machine learning – to speed decision-making across all warfighting domains.

Time Sensitive Networking (TSN) is a set of Ethernet networking capabilities used to transmit time-sensitive data across standard Ethernet networks. Originally, TSN grew out of the IEEE 802.1 standard working groups on Audio Video Bridging (AVB) to make sure that independent networks streams for audio and video data arrive at the correct times to ensure synchronization. AVB also requires guaranteed delivery throughput and latency to avoid problems like missing video frames. Today, TSN features new 802.1 standards and enhancements that go beyond AVB time-synchronized streaming and can support low-latency, precision data delivery over Ethernet for a broader set of industrial, automotive, aerospace, and other real-time communications applications.
